Abstract
This study describes a student-based improvement as a mixed method of quantitative and qualitative research on reading the reader's theatre (RT) that might enhance students' fluency, motivation level, and reading comprehension. This research aimed to improve students' fluency, motivation, and reading comprehension through the reader's theatre in the UAE's preparatory classes. The context of the research was in a government school in Ras Al Khaimah, in the United Arab Emirates, and the sample size was five students of the same abilities of motivation and fluency. The methods were students' performance of reader's theatre script twice a week and repeated reading. Date was triangulated for validity and reliability purpose like the reflective journal, self-evaluation checklist, audience-evaluation checklist, motivation questionnaire, interview and reading comprehension with teachers and principal. The major findings were: 1) It Appears that RT can improve students' fluency in preparatory classes 2) It appears that RT can improve students' motivation in preparatory classes 3) it appears that RT can improves student reading comprehension.
